PDA

Просмотр полной версии : Проблема с расширением памяти до 128кБ на КА1515ХМ1



julbu
08.01.2020, 23:58
Господа, пытаюсь сделать расширение памяти до 128кБ на спектруме с КА1515ХМ1. Плата как тут https://zx-pk.ru/threads/28026-sborka-nastrojka-plat-nedolut2017.html версия 2 на двух TMS44C256. Схема расширения вот эта, реализована схемным вводом на плис EPM7032 (проверял несколько раз).
71194
Сделал доп. плату с 16-ю микросхемами памяти KM4164 - результат теста:
71195
Память исправна, подключал без схемы расширения, поочередно CAS1 и CAS2 на CAS со спектрума.
Пробовал на 2-х TMS44C256 на выводы 1 (A8) подавать сигнал с вывода 5 D9, как тут советуют https://www.cxemateka.ru/ru/nafanya-zx_spectrum_128k_compatibility_upgrade, на выходе вот такая картинка:
71196
До этого делал расширение Ленинграда 2 на 565РУ7, тоже на ПЛИС EPM7032, заработало сразу - без настроек.
Может кто то сталкивался с подобным проявлением работы спектрума на БМК при расширении памяти? Подскажите в каком направлении копать :)

solegstar
09.01.2020, 00:58
Пробовал на 2-х TMS44C256 на выводы 1 (A8) подавать сигнал с вывода 5 D9
Вот это я не совсем понял. у TMS44C256 в DIP корпусе старший адрес А8 находится на 15 выводе. Возможно имелось ввиду 1 вывод джампера J2 платы компа? если следовать аналогии расширения ленинграда до 128кб на ру7, то Вам нужно подключить сигнал с 5 вывода D9 схемы расширения на сигнал АМ8 компа, т.е. к 15 выводу микросхем памяти или к 1 выводу джампера J2. Если джампер замкнут, его нужно разомкнуть.
По фото такое ощущение, как будто у Вас кз на адресах памяти.
и еще, память ведь 256кб, дополнительная линейка ОЗУ по идее не нужна.

julbu
09.01.2020, 09:29
Да, прошу прощения, к TMS44C256 А8 подключал к 15 выводу. Изначально, я планировал использовать для расширения KM4164 - 16 шт. но не заработало. Думал проблема в формировании сигналов CAS (смотрел на осциллографе сигналы CAS1 и CAS2 - они довольно сложной формы и не похожи по длительности фронтов), поэтому попробовал на TMS44C256 с формированием сигнала А8. Возможно ли, что формирование старших-младших адресов выборки памяти на БМК нестандартное? Может были разные ревизии КА1515ХМ1.

doorsfan
09.01.2020, 09:57
внимательно разберись с обрывом или коротышем А7 от z80 в сторону ХМ1 и твоего расширения памяти.

julbu
09.01.2020, 10:20
внимательно разберись с обрывом или коротышем А7 от z80 в сторону ХМ1 и твоего расширения памяти.

Извините, немного не понял. A7 от Z80 на БМК? Так 48к работает без проблем, игры грузятся, тесты проходят. Заказал лог. анализатор, будем мучать. Осциллографа не достаточно.

tank-uk
09.01.2020, 13:05
julbu, У меня по этой схеме работает на 41256, только CAS не формируется а с 5 ноги ТМ2 берется AR8
https://zx-pk.ru/threads/26906-plm-x48k.html?p=916264&viewfull=1#post916264

вот схема
https://drive.google.com/open?id=1mWwGIeR6zr7rjvGV9eIQs7sdwp_u_b1t

julbu
09.01.2020, 13:35
tank-uk, спасибо. Вы мне уже высылали эту схему. К сожалению у меня "не взлетело".

Dotoro
15.01.2020, 17:24
К сожалению у меня "не взлетело".
А есть ли решение "все в одном" AY + "память 128+" + диск/сд?